1473 beautiful names found. Discover the perfect Islamic name with deep spiritual roots.
Meaning: Mufakkir is an Arabic name that means 'thinker' or 'contemplator'. It conveys the idea of someone who is thoughtful, reflective, and contemplative in their approach to life.
Meaning: Mufid is an Arabic name that means 'useful', 'beneficial', or 'valuable'. It carries the connotation of being helpful or advantageous.
Meaning: Muhafiz is an Arabic name that means 'protector', 'guardian', or 'defender'. It reflects the idea of someone who takes care of and watches over others.
Meaning: Muhannad is an Arabic name that means 'sword blade' or 'sharp sword'. It symbolizes strength, courage, and determination.
Meaning: Muheet is an Arabic name that means 'comprehensive' or 'encompassing'. It signifies someone who is vast in knowledge or has a broad understanding of various subjects.
Meaning: Muizz means 'one who gives honor, dignity, or exaltation'. It is associated with the qualities of bestowing greatness and significance upon others.
Meaning: Mumayyaz is an Arabic name that means distinguished, eminent, outstanding, or remarkable. It conveys the idea of someone who stands out or excels in a particular way.
Meaning: Munerah is an Arabic name for girls which means illuminating, shedding light.
Meaning: Munif is an Arabic name that means 'exalted' or 'noble'. It conveys the idea of someone who holds a high rank or status.
Meaning: Munirah is an Arabic feminine name derived from the root word 'n-w-r' which means 'radiant' or 'shining'. It signifies someone who is bright, radiant, and filled with light.
Meaning: Munize is an Arabic name for girls that means 'one who comforts and consoles others', 'one who brings tranquility and peace'.
Meaning: Muntaha is an Arabic name that means 'the ultimate goal' or 'the highest point'. It signifies reaching the pinnacle or achieving the utmost success in life.
Meaning: Muqbalah means 'received' or 'accepted' in Arabic. It signifies being welcomed or acknowledged in a positive way.
Meaning: Murtada is an Arabic name meaning 'chosen' or 'preferred'. It conveys the idea of being selected or favored.
Meaning: Murtadaa is an Arabic name that means 'chosen' or 'selected'. It conveys the sense of being preferred or selected by Allah.
Meaning: Musad in Arabic means 'supported' or 'helper'. It carries the connotation of someone who provides assistance or aid to others.
Meaning: Musaid is an Arabic name that means 'helper' or 'supporter'. It is derived from the Arabic word 'saada', which means to support or assist.
Meaning: Mushira is an Arabic name that means 'counselor', 'advisor', or 'consultant'. It is derived from the Arabic root 'sh-r-a', which conveys the idea of providing advice or guidance.
Meaning: Muskaan is an Arabic name that means 'smile' or 'happiness'. It conveys the idea of a cheerful and joyful demeanor.
Meaning: Muskan is another variant of the name Muskaan, which is of Arabic origin and means 'smile' or 'happiness'. It conveys the idea of joy and contentment.
Meaning: Muslim is derived from the Arabic word 'Muslim,' which means 'one who submits to Allah'. It signifies a person who follows the Islamic faith and submits themselves to the will of Allah.
Meaning: Mussaret is an Arabic name that means 'joyful' or 'happy'. It conveys a sense of happiness and delight.
Meaning: Mussarrat is an Arabic name that means 'joy' or 'happiness'. It conveys the idea of someone who brings happiness and joy to others.
Meaning: Mustafeed is an Arabic name that means 'one who is benefited' or 'one who receives advantage or profit'. It conveys the sense of being someone who gains benefits or advantage from situations or experiences.
Meaning: Mustaneer is an Arabic name that means 'enlightened' or 'illumined'. It carries the connotation of being filled with light or brightness.
Meaning: Mutahhir is an Arabic name that means 'purifier' or 'one who purifies'. It is derived from the Arabic word 'tahara', which means purity or cleanliness.
Meaning: Muznah is an Arabic name that means 'fragrant' or 'aromatic'. It conveys the idea of something with a pleasant scent.
Meaning: Myiesha is a variant spelling of the Arabic name Aisha, derived from the root 'aisha' meaning 'alive' or 'living'. It conveys the idea of vitality and lively spirit.
Meaning: Mysha is an Arabic name that means lively, full of life, or vivacious.
Meaning: The name Naazneen is of Persian origin and means 'charming', 'delicate', or 'beloved'. It conveys the idea of being beautiful and lovely.
Meaning: Naba is an Arabic name that means 'news' or 'announcement'. It symbolizes the bringing of important tidings or information.
Meaning: Nabeel is an Arabic name that means 'noble' or 'generous'. It conveys the idea of someone who possesses honorable qualities and is known for his kindness and generosity.
Meaning: Noble or distinguished.
Meaning: Nabilah is an Arabic feminine name that means 'noble' or 'excellent'. It conveys the idea of someone who possesses exceptional qualities and character.
Meaning: Nada is an Arabic name that means 'generosity' or 'dew drops'. It is often associated with being kind-hearted and giving.
Meaning: Nadeem is an Arabic name meaning 'one who is friendly and affable'. It is derived from the Arabic word 'nudm', which conveys the idea of congeniality and warmth towards others.
Meaning: Nadesh is an Arabic name that means 'one who walks softly' or 'one who has a gentle gait.' It conveys a sense of grace, elegance, and subtle movement.
Meaning: Nadia is an Arabic name that means 'caller', 'announcer', or 'moist'. It is also associated with the concept of 'hope' and 'generosity'.
Meaning: Nadwa is an Arabic name that means 'council' or 'gathering'. It is often associated with gatherings of intellectuals or advisors.
Meaning: Nadyne is a variation of Nadine, which means 'hope' or 'delicate' in Arabic.
Meaning: Naeemah is an Arabic feminine name that means 'blessing', 'bliss', or 'delight'. It conveys the idea of something that brings joy and contentment.
Meaning: Nageen is an Arabic name that is derived from the root word 'n-j-n,' which means something precious, valuable, or rare.
Meaning: Nageenah is an Arabic name that means 'precious gem' or 'valuable stone'. It symbolizes something precious and beautiful, like a gemstone.
Meaning: Nagheen is an Arabic name that means 'precious', 'valuable', or 'priceless'. It conveys the idea of something of great worth or significance.
Meaning: Nagina is an Arabic name that means 'jewel' or 'precious stone'. It is often used to symbolize something valuable and beautiful.
Meaning: Nahid is an Arabic name that means 'one who has an elevated rank or status', 'a distinguished or prominent individual'. It conveys the idea of someone who is highly respected or honored.
Meaning: Nahleejah is derived from the Arabic word 'nahlah' which means 'a bee'. It symbolizes beauty, hard work, and productivity.
Meaning: Nailah is an Arabic name for girls that means 'successful', 'attainer', 'acquirer', 'one who reaches her goals.' It is a name with positive connotations related to achieving success and fulfilling aspirations.